Review: Southern is the insurer for the at-fault driver in an accident where my car was struck from behind on 10/20/2015. While Southern has accepted liability for the accident, and has paid on repairs to my vehicle, they are not being responsive to my claim for diminished value for the damage done to my car. I submitted my claim, along with an independent, in-person appraisal documenting the diminished value of my vehicle on 1/7/16. To date, while Gwen [redacted], the representative for Southern handling the claim has acknowledged receipt of the claim, there has been no action taken in the three weeks following.Desired Settlement: Timely response and a fair-dealing outcome regarding my claim.
